Default AVIC D3 with BOYO backup camera Problems!

Hello,

I have an avic D3 and a BOYO license plate backup camera. Camera had 3 wires, the yellow RCA, red and black. Yellow RCA i hooked up to the rear backup camera plug on the D3, black wire grounded, and red wire i tried to hook up to various wires in the rear that i thought would have a 12v current.

However when i use the D3 to select backup camera, it shows just a black screen.

Any suggestions?

I attempted to tap into the white/black reverse light wire, for camera power as well as that little trunk light. Thanks for the help!

Found out after very much trial and error:

Tap power wire of camera to ACC wire of headunit.

Tap reverse signal of Avic D3 to the pink reverse wire underneath the glove box.

Ground camera wire to one of many locations on trunk hatch.

All these hours to figure that out...
